NFTs are tokens that we can use to represent ownership of unique items . They let us tokenise things like art, collectibles, even real estate. They can only have one official owner at a time and they’re secured by the Ethereum blockchain – no one can modify the record of ownership or copy/paste a new NFT into existence.

The letters NFT stand for Non-Fungible Token . A Non-Fungible Token is a piece of code on a computer that exists in a fashion similar to that of cryptocurrency like Bitcoin. Like any object, physical or digital, an NFT is only worth what someone will pay to own it.

So what exactly are NFTs? They’re digital tokens, often purchased with the virtual currency Ether, that record ownership of a unique asset . You buy NFTs on online marketplaces like OpenSea. One collection from Bored Ape Yacht Club had a $3 million daily trading volume as of mid-February.
